John Ruskin Quotes
We Are Always In These Days Endeavoring To Separate Intellect And Manual Labor; We Want One Man To Be Always Thinking, And Another To Be Always Working, And We Call One A Gentleman, And The Other An Operative; Whereas The Workman Ought Often To Be Thinking, And The Thinker Often To Be Working, And Both Should Be Gentlemen In The Best Sense.
